The urgency to reinvent manufacturing
Manufacturers today face growing pressure to deliver faster, more cost-effectively, and with greater precision. Aging infrastructure, fragmented supply chains, and rising operational costs make it difficult to stay competitive. Without smart manufacturing technologies, real-time data visibility, and connected systems, scaling and adapting in the Industry 4.0 era becomes a major challenge.
Technology
Legacy systems that block innovation
Many factories continue to rely on outdated machinery and disconnected IT infrastructure. These legacy systems limit visibility, slow automation efforts, and make it difficult to deploy technologies like IoT, digital twins, or AI-powered analytics.
Supply chain
Disrupted supply chains and poor visibility
Global disruptions, logistics delays, and unpredictable demand have exposed supply chain vulnerabilities. Without real-time tracking and intelligent forecasting, planning becomes reactive and error-prone.
Data silo
Scattered data and disconnected systems
When production, inventory, and logistics data are stored in isolated systems, it becomes nearly impossible to make fast, informed decisions. This fragmentation reduces efficiency and increases the risk of delays or costly mistakes.
Labor
Workforce gaps and manual dependency
Skilled labor shortages and reliance on manual processes reduce productivity and consistency. Without automation, teams are stuck performing repetitive tasks that could be streamlined through digital workflows or robotic process automation.
Sustainability
Pressure to meet sustainability goals
Sustainability expectations are rising, but many manufacturers lack the tools to monitor energy consumption, emissions, and waste. Without smart sensors and environmental data tracking, it's difficult to meet ESG and compliance requirements.
